Fungal Biotechnology is an important publication representing these advances and multiple roles played by fungi. This includes mostly industrial applications of fungi for the production of pigments, citric acid and vitamins, beneficial effects of mycorrhizal fungi, mycoviruses, biotransformation, and also various health implications. All aspects of cultivating fungi together with products and processes derived from such cultures. Fungi exhibit a wide rangeof biosynthetic and biodegradative activities. These species impact us in diverse ways, such as generating the food we eat and drink, providing life-saving pharmaceutical agents, and are sources of enzymes; and yet they adversely affect the structural integrity of our buildings, poison us, cause common mycoses and in not so rare cases can kill us, and they are the principal group of microbes responsible for plant diseases that threaten global food security.
